Birthday Card; Botanical Builder framelits

Well I am safe to share this now as the recipient has received it on time!  And for me, that was a great achievement as I had to send it to New Zealand and I am always forgetting how long cards take to get there.



I just love this card. I did CASE it from someone who created a wedding card using the same idea however I cannot recall who it was. If you know I'd love to give them credit!

Isn't it just beautiful? It is also very simple to make; Stampin' Up! have amazing products that let you create beautiful items. 

I've used a couple of stamp sets; gorgeous grunge for the background (a must have set) and Butterfly Basics for the sentiment.  The flowers are made with the Botanical Builder Framelits - another must have set.

Hope you like it; I know that the recipient did and that's what is important.

Colour Challenge

One of the great things about being a Stampin' Up! demonstrator is that you get to be part of a bigger family of demonstrators. I am so luckily to be part of a group called Stampin' Twinklets; a group of local demonstrators.

Recently a colour challenge was set for the Stampin' Twinklets by one of the members and the colours were these;





Not exactly colours I normally work with but I thought why not give it a go as I love any opportunity to craft.

So I came up with this;



I actually love it!  The flower and leaves are from the Botanical Builder Framelits set; an amazing set! and the dots are from the Polka Dot embossing folder.  I often forget about my embossing folders and was really pleased that I remembered that I had this one as I think it makes a lovely background.

A bit of gold thread to finish it off and there it is!

I purposefully left it without a sentiment as I decided that I liked it as it was.

Oh, in case you're wondering the colours I used were Early Espresso and Delightful Djion; glad I didn't have to use them all!  The background is Very Vanilla; one of my favourite colours at the moment and within the rules in case you were wondering.

Hope you like the simplicity of the card like I do and Happy Crafting!
